Abstract
A design of a new hybrid-type digital pulse-width modulator (DPWM) with a 1000:1 frequency range from 10kHz to 10-MHz, maximum resolution of 11-bits, and power dissipation of 2.36-mW is presented. The key to such a wide frequency range and low power dissipation is to use a phase interpolator circuit for fine duty-cycle adjustment instead of the delay lines used in the previous literature. The proposed hybrid DPWM realizes the upper 5-bit resolution using a digital counter and lower 6-bit using a phase interpolator. The prototype IC fabricated in a 0.25-μm HV CMOS demonstrates the 1000:1 frequency range and excellent linearity for 9~11-bit resolutions.
